I've seen (and supported) a social angle, but more along the lines of: high 
ranking nobles and powerful megacorporations allow piracy to exist, mostly 
towards their own financial ends. Pirates a noble.megacorp supports are his 
"off the books" navy. The pirates are "used" to attack rivals shipping 
(sometimes they attack your shipping but that's just the cost of doing 
business).

Otherwise, without behind the scenes interference, the Imperial navy (with it's 
resources) should have crushed piracy centuries ago and kept it suppressed 
(only having to deal with the rare new pirate).
